Motivated in finding a non-relativistic counterpart of the conjectured duality between the Jackiw-Teitelboim (JT) gravity model and the quantum mechanical Sachdev-Ye-Kitaev (SYK) model we consider a two dimensional dilaton model with Lifshitz-like symmetries. We show how this dilaton model arises from a dimensional reduction of a Lifshitz-like black hole. We derive a one dimensional Lifshitz boundary action which only retains U(1) symmetries (as opposed to the SL(2,R) symmetries of the Schwarzian action) and use this boundary action to compute logarithmic corrections to the entropy of the Lifshitz-like black hole.
